Response Format
The getWeight() method returns an array with:
[
'weight' => '0.133 kg', // What the scale's own display shows
'gross' => 0.133, // Gross weight
'tare' => 0.0, // Tare
'net' => 0.133, // Gross minus tare
'unit' => 'kg',
'stable' => true, // False while the reading is still settling
'net_displayed' => false, // True when the scale is displaying net, not gross
'status_code' => null, // Scale status code when it cannot report a weight
'success' => true,
'error' => null,
]
weight mirrors whichever of gross/net the scale itself is displaying, at the
scale's own resolution.
When the scale cannot report a weight it streams a status frame instead, and
success is false with status_code set and error describing it:
status_code |
Meaning |
|---|---|
| 1 | Flash memory error |
| 2 | ADC failure |
| 3 | Load cell signal out of range |
| 4 / 5 | Load cell signal too high / too low |
| 7 | Overload — weight exceeds the scale maximum |
| 8 | Scale is not showing a weight (display shows dashes) |
Status code 8 is normal: it is what the scale reports when it is idle with nothing on the platform.
Reading continuously (multiple consumers)
A scale can only usefully be read by one process at a time:
- Its UDP receive port can only be usefully bound once per host — two readers on the same machine will steal each other's datagrams.
- Its streaming state is global, so a client that stops the stream blinds every other reader, on every machine.
getWeight() is therefore only appropriate for occasional one-off reads. To serve
many consumers, have a single process own the stream and publish the readings for
everything else to consume:
$scale = new XtremScale('192.168.1.100', 4444, 5555); $scale->openStream(); // binds the socket, starts the stream while (true) { // Multiplex with socket_select() across several scales if needed while (($reading = $scale->readStreamFrame()) !== null) { $latest = $reading; // the scale pushes ~14 frames/sec } $scale->keepStreamAlive(); // periodically re-assert the stream // publish $latest somewhere shared (cache, Redis, ...) } $scale->closeStream();
Neither getWeight() nor closeStream() sends the stop command, precisely so that
one consumer can never switch off another's stream.

Network Configuration
The Gram Xtreme F-06 scale uses UDP communication:
- Send Port: 4445 (commands sent to scale)
- Receive Port: 5556 (data received from scale)
Ensure your firewall allows UDP traffic on these ports.
